#4b5b87 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b5b87 is composed of 29.4% red, 35.7%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#4b5b87 color hex could be obtained by blending #96b6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#4b5b87 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b5b87 has RGB values of R:75, G:91,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4938631.

Hex triplet 4b5b87 #4b5b87
RGB Decimal 75, 91, 135 rgb(75,91,135)
RGB Percent 29.4, 35.7, 52.9 rgb(29.4%,35.7%,52.9%)
CMYK 44, 33, 0, 47
HSL 224°, 28.6, 41.2 hsl(224,28.6%,41.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 224°, 44.4, 52.9
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 39.117, 6.201, -26.469
XYZ 11.015, 10.727, 24.41
xyY 0.239, 0.232, 10.727
CIE-LCH 39.117, 27.186, 283.185
CIE-LUV 39.117, -9.211, -37.899
Hunter-Lab 32.752, 2.716, -21.263
Binary 01001011, 01011011, 10000111

Shades and Tints of #4b5b87

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050609 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.
